Acid-base Disorders Treatment Cost: Mexico, Guadalajara vs Turkey

Introduction & Clinical Importance

Acid-base disorders in Nephrology involve imbalances like metabolic acidosis or alkalosis, often due to kidney dysfunction, affecting pH, electrolytes, and breathing. Treatment—via fluids, electrolytes, bicarbonate, or dialysis—prevents organ damage and improves quality of life by restoring balance and reducing fatigue or breathlessness.
